A 52-year-old woman has CKD G3b (eGFR 38 mL/min/1.73m2) and is on maximum RASi, SGLT2i, and statin. Her uACR is 25 mg/mmol and BP 126/78 mmHg on amlodipine and ramipril. Using the KFRE (Kidney Failure Risk Equation) 5-year risk calculator, her predicted risk of kidney failure within 5 years is 4%. What does this risk estimate MOST usefully inform?

Correct answer: CTiming of referral for renal replacement therapy education

The KFRE (Kidney Failure Risk Equation) integrates age, sex, eGFR, and uACR to predict 2-year and 5-year risk of kidney failure (eGFR <15 or KRT). KDIGO 2024 recommends using KFRE to guide timing of RRT education, access planning, and transplant referral. A 5-year risk of 4% is low, indicating that intensive RRT planning is not yet needed, but this patient should continue nephrology follow-up with serial KFRE recalculation. NICE recommends RRT education when 5-year risk exceeds 10-20%, and access formation when risk exceeds 20%. The KFRE empowers individualised planning rather than eGFR-threshold-based triggers.
